BUT THERE IS A SOLUTION

WRITE DOWN THE MOST IMPORTANT ASPECTS FOR YOU!

We are all different.

  • Maybe yoga and meditation can go into one category, Maybe it can even be a part of your workout category.
  • Maybe you can find a way to start your day with a cup of warm water and lemon before your coffee.
  • Maybe your smoothie can include a mixture that has your vitamins and fibre too.
  • Schedule in the important things and make it consistent.
  • Example: walk dog everyday at a specific times daily.
  • Do your yoga or workout 1st thing in the morning.
  • Always have water with you.
  • Make Sunday’s grocery shopping day…

These are just a few examples.

The bottom line is, find something that works for you.

You might need to hire someone to help you at first, but soon enough you will start to accomplish more in your day and the overwhelming feelings will slowly start to fade.

Whatever is important to you will come up to the surface and you will start to see progress and success.
